This course is great for new roadway cyclists as well as more experienced cyclists.

Course topics include:

  • How to perfectly fit your bike to you
  • Basic bike mechanics: Fix-a-flat and other common repairs
  • VA Bike laws
  • Handling and Signalling
  • Where to ride in relation to cars
  • Crash Avoidance and Common Mistakes
  • Shifting Tips
  • Group Riding Skills

The course will focus on riding skills that are specific to the Charlottesville area. Course time will be split between classroom instruction, parking lot skills practice, and on-road riding.
